Output 51ef32fb630a7ffc540967eb4fa8625ac42e6b879997c057c458673593f359f9:81

value
10000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 695e1c99bd4ac859b36c53af2df12bdd9811c7437e0e5f8a81d49ad8550f566c
address
bc1pd90pexdafty9nvmv2whjmuftmkvpr36r0c89lz5p6jdds4g02ekqhyxzea
transaction
51ef32fb630a7ffc540967eb4fa8625ac42e6b879997c057c458673593f359f9
spent
true